Science Riddles About Moon 

Science Riddles About Moon 

  1. I cause tides and pull Earth’s oceans, though I never touch water.
    Answer: The Moon’s gravity
  2. I orbit Earth once every 27 days, but my face stays the same.
    Answer: Tidal locking
  3. My shaking isn’t from nerves. It’s underground motion in a quiet lunar world.
    Answer: Moonquake
  4. I shine, but I’m not lit. My glow comes from sunlight’s reflection.
    Answer: The Moon
  5. I have no air, but I’m covered in powdery dust and craters.
    Answer: The Moon’s surface
  6. I’m born from collision, not creation. My origin comes from a giant impact.
    Answer: Giant Impact Hypothesis
  7. I appear full every 29.5 days. What am I tracking?
    Answer: Synodic cycle
  8. I have weak gravity, no weather and  a surface older than Earth.
    Answer: The Moon
  9. My thin outer gas layer isn’t breathable. What surrounds me?
    Answer: Moon’s exosphere
  10. I don’t have volcanoes or rain, but I still show signs of movement.
    Answer: The Moon
  11. I rotate exactly once per orbit. That’s why you only see one side.
    Answer: Synchronous rotation
  12. My light changes, but I don’t. What causes me to seem different?
    Answer: Moon phases
  13. I wobble slightly in my path, creating small shifts in what you see.
    Answer: Lunar libration
  14. I’m dry, rocky and  lifeless, but I still influence life on Earth.
    Answer: The Moon
  15. I lack protection from solar rays because I don’t have this.
    Answer: Atmosphere

Moon Festival Riddles

Moon Festival Riddles

Not only does the moon provide science opportunities, but also part of celebrations. These moon festival riddles will give a little glimmer of your “ankh” for traditions such as, Mid-Autumn Festival, Mooncake Night and Lantern Celebrations. These are great for holiday games with family, cultural learning experiences or for fun with family under a festive full moon.

  1. I shine with joy among the festivities while surrounded by lanterns and laughter. What is the light in the sky?
    Answer: Full Moon
  2. I’m eaten once a year, sweet and round, filled with love and sometimes nuts.
    Answer: Mooncake
  3. I float with fire, paper and  wishes glowing gently in festival night skies.
    Answer: Lantern
  4. I’m a goddess in Chinese myth, living alone with a rabbit on the moon.
    Answer: Chang’e
  5. I hop without sound, brew tea on the moon and  come from legend.
    Answer: Jade Rabbit
  6. I’m a festival of harvest, family and  light celebrated under a full moon.
    Answer: Moon Festival
  7. I light up rice fields during harvest, marking time to gather and celebrate.
    Answer: Harvest Moon
  8. I’m the reason people look up, eat cakes and  light lanterns.
    Answer: Full Moon
  9. I’m a night for poetry, mooncakes and  glowing lights shaped like stars.
    Answer: Mid-Autumn Festival
  10. I’m filled with red bean or lotus paste and wrapped in tradition.
    Answer: Mooncake
  11. I rise in story, culture and  sky always honored during fall’s brightest night.
    Answer: Full Moon
  12. I’m a symbol of reunion, family and  light always present in autumn skies.
    Answer: Full Moon
  13. I come alive in legends, glowing softly behind bamboo forests.
    Answer: Moon Rabbit
  14. I hang in windows, float in rivers and  shine in every festival photo.
    Answer: Lanterns
  15. It’s time to gaze, give thanks and  dream under moonlight’s calm.
    Answer: Moon Festival night
